Thank you for helping provide resources that make a real impact in their daily learning experience.","fullyFundedDate":1771617817963,"projectUrl":"project/mice-for-chromebooks/10092964/","projectTitle":"MICE for Chromebooks","teacherDisplayName":"Ms. Martinez","teacherPhotoUrl":"https://cdn.donorschoose.net/images/placeholder-avatars/272/teacher-placeholder-4_272.png?auto=webp","teacherClassroomUrl":"classroom/7887346"},{"teacherId":7887346,"projectId":9715856,"letterContent":"Thank you for the Sphero robots,\r\nMy students and I have enjoyed learning to program with them. The current project that we have done with them is to design and build a maze then program a sphero robot to go through the maze. Students have had a great time learning how to program using the sphero robots. \r\n \r\nFor many of my students using the sphero robots allows them to apply their math and science knowledge in a creative and fun way with the programming. The spheros think in 360 degrees. Therefore students have to think how many degrees make a left turn, a right turn. What degree angle will make the sphero go backward. Students use their knowledge of velocity and acceleration to use the roll commands and other programming commands. \r\n\r\nThank you so much for the donation. About this school
Truman Middle School is
an urban public school
in Albuquerque, New Mexico that is part of Albuquerque Public Schools.
It serves 574 students
in grades 6 - 8 with a student/teacher ratio of 7.8:1.
Its teachers have had 45 projects funded on DonorsChoose.
